50 activists of KRV were arrested in Bangalore a few hours back as they tried to storm the house of urban development minister Shri Kumar in Bangalore.
The activists were protesting in front of the ministers house while the 40 member delegation of Belgaum city councilors were meeting him and explaining the happenings of yesterday at the corporation.
The KRV is saying that what happened yesterday is all correct and Belgaum Mayor is a Kannadiga and we are proud of it.
A privilege motion was raised in the Maharashtra assembly but was not accepted by the speaker, but he agreed to have a discussion on the same. CM Ashok Chavan of Maharashtra said that whatever happned yesterday is another way of the Karnataka govt. to pressurize Marathis in the state. Ashok Chavan will write a letter to BSY expressing his regret over the Mayors election.
Bangalore Police badly beat the KRV activists.
The Police also urged the 40 member councilors team to leave the city and go back to Belgaum as their presence can cause law and order problems.. The team has left Bangalore in the afternoon.

Scenes of yesterday of the Belgaum city corporation bring great dis honor to democracy. The outgoing mayor and presiding officer rejected all other forms except of Mr.Nirwani on technical grounds of wrong address and incomplete forms of namely of six candidates –– Dhanraj Gavali, Latifkhan Pathan, Shanta Uppar, Sadiq Inamdar, Netaji Jadhav and Kiran Sayanak.

Latifkhan Pathan, backed by the councillors of Maharashtra Ekikaran Samiti, raised a hue and cry in the House and rushed to the Mayor’s podium.
The new mayor who is a lawyer himself, Mr.Nirwani took his chair on his own and adjourned the meeting and hence the Dy. Mayor could not be elected.
All this was planned by the MLA's it is said.
Of the 58, 29 councillors belonged to the Kannada group, 28 to MES and one remained neutral, besides four MLAs -- Firoz Sait and Satish Jarkiholi (both Congress), Sanjay Patil and Abhay Patil (both BJP) and MP Suresh Angadi. The Kannada-speaking faction was supported by all four legislators cutting across party lines and hence their victory was sure. But the twist in the story was done by the king maker Sambhaji Patil who split from the Kannada faction 11 members made a breakaway group along with the Marathi speaking group.
This split within the ruling faction was known to the ruling group and hence the rejection of nomination was sought.
 40 members left for Bangalore yesterday 28 Marathi speaking along with 10 Kannada and Urdu group members along with Sambhaji Patil and Kamar to meet the governor. The group will also meet CM and ministers and also plan to meet the president of India and get the election of the Mayor canceled.

Nirwani is the new Mayor of Belgaum

3:31 PM Posted by ukmad


Sri. Nirwani Ningappa Balappa councilor from ward 52 has been elected as the mayor of Belgaum. He is part of the Kannada group and the ruling party has been successful in retaining power.


All was not well as he took charge as prior to his election six nominations were rejected and Nirwani was elected unopposed which paved for fierce protests from the opposition. The opposition Marathi speaking councilors were seen throwing foot gear at the newly elected Mayor and also destructed some furniture in the hall.
After all this the election of Dy. Mayor and elections of the standing committees was postponed for a month.
The corporation today saw some very unruly scenes inside the house and the election of the Deputy mayor were postponed.

Tomorrow the elected councilors will vote to elect the 22nd Mayor for Belgaum.
In the 26 year history of the corporation 19 times a Marathi speaking was a mayor and the rest were Kannada speaking.
Belgaum has a unique distinction of its Mayoral election for that matter even the election to the city Corporation, elsewhere, where political parties like BJP, Congress, JDS field in candidates in Belgaum there are no officials party candidates, all most all stand as independents belonging to 3 major groups – Marathi speaking, Kannada Speaking & Urdu speaking.
Sambhaji Patil has been elected Mayor on Four occasions and Vandana Belgundkar twice.

Belgaum will have 2 subways and one indoor stadium

1:18 PM Posted by ukmad


Under the 100 crore plan Belgaum will get TWO subways for pedestrians and one indoor stadium. The plan has been sent for approval and once the same is approved the work will commence.
The two subways planned are at: DC office to court and another one at fish market to Anthony school. On the empty land of the corporation in Malmaruti an indoor stadium will be built.
Rs.75 lakhs each for the subway and Rs.5 crore is the cost estimated for the indoor stadium. The said project were finalized yesterday at a meet held in Bangalore by district minister Bsavraj Bommai.

Water tariff hike angers citizens

12:36 PM Posted by ukmad


The 10 wards in which there is 24x7 water supply got a shock when they got the months water bill. For some it was even more than their electricity bill. The citizens of the 10 wards and the citizens' forum yesterday dashed to the office of Belgaum City Corporation and took corporation commissioner on the task.
The citizens said that this water tariff hike was unreasonable, unaffordable, illogical, unscientific, irrational, unethical and totally unjustifiable and demanded the corporation to withdraw this “unacceptable” rates and restore previous rates with immediate effect. No one will pay their bills until and unless the bills are revised to the earlier rates.

The existing tariff, where the minimum monthly charges was Rs. 83 for a usage of 15,000 litres and an additional Rs. 5.60/1,000 litres, the residents have to pay Rs. 48 for 8,000 litres and Rs. 104 for 15,000 litres a month. Similarly, for different slabs of usages, the corporation has increased price by Rs. 21 to Rs. 1,005 a month.

So earlier if you used to pay Rs.83 now you will land up paying Rs.104 for the 15,000 litres of water. Which is a 25% increase.
Many citizens urged that they do not need 24x7 water supply and they would be happy with the two hour water supply.
The commissioner said that he had no powers to reduce the tariff. The citizens plan an agitation against this in the future.  

IBM opens Center of Excellence at GIT

11:59 AM Posted by ukmad

A “Center of Excellence” was launched by IBM at the Gogte Institute of Technology to foster innovation.
A Memorandum of Understanding was signed between the college and IBM to give a concrete shape to the collaboration between the two institutions with the objective of imparting training to build skilled human resource base on leading software technologies.
Earlier, the IBM organized “Develothon 2010”, a IBM programme aimed at helping the software developer community in India develop skills in newer technology areas at GIT.
The company is organizing a 32-city road show and integrates with its developer works forum, known for extensive skill coverage and software evangelisation. During Develothon 2010, resource persons from IBM briefed the students and faculty about cloud computing and web 2.0, smarter planet.

Milind Gadagkar from Belgaum ready to Phoonk 2

12:46 PM Posted by ukmad



He loves to scare his audience. After giving us the goosebumps in Phoonk as a writer, Milind Gadagkar has now turned director and is all set to scare us with his debut Phoonk-2. An engineer from Belgaum, Milind shifted to Pune in 2001. After working with a company for a while, he realised his real passion — films. So, he quite his job and shifted to Mumbai. It was Ram Gopal Varma who gave Milind his first break as a writer in Phoonk. The movie is all set to release on April 16.


Milind with Ram Gopal Varma

Milind did his engineering from GIT(Gogte institute of Technology).
When Milind gave Ramu the idea of Phoonk-2, Ramu agreed and said Milind you would be the best person to direct it.
In Phoonk 2, Milind wanted to take the audiences to a place where the horrors are so painfully, scary and gory that even a rational mind will lose its sanity.
Milind feels that Phoonk was more of an emotional drama because the scare factor comes through helplessness that the parents go through. While Phoonk-2 starts off with the spirit of an evil woman coming back from the dead and brutally murdering the tantrik. The fear factor in Phoonk-2 is very high. Since, the tantrik is dead, the danger the ghost poses for the family is very high, making the film scarier.


From the Phoonk 2 sets


Movie enters the lives of a couple (played by Sudeep and Amruta Khanvilkar) and their kids (Ahsaas Channa, Shrey Bawa) who continue to be haunted by the evil force (Ashwini Kalsekar) which is back from the dead. However, situations this time around are entirely new.
The movie shooting was started in the month of October and finished the entire principal shooting in 37 days.

Belgaum varsity special officer appointed

6:41 PM Posted by ukmad

Prof. B.R. Ananthan, Member-Secretary, Karnataka State Higher Education Board, has been appointed as the special officer of newly-created Belgaum University. Prof. Ananthan had retired after serving as the Head of the Department of Commerce in the University of Mysore and had been appointed to the newly-formed Higher Education Board.
Having been appointed as the special officer, it is said that it paves the way to his appointment as the Vice-Chancellor of the University.
